Abstract

The invention discloses a garbage collection device and a big data garbage classification management system using the garbage collection device. The garbage collection device includes a control module, an ID card reader, a delivery operation panel, a communication module and several sorting garbage bins. The sorting garbage bins It includes a box body, an upper box cover, an installation partition, a monitoring device and a plurality of actuators, the installation partition is fixed on the top opening of the box, the upper box cover is installed on the installation partition, the The sorting garbage bin opening on the top of the upper box cover is provided with a cover opening and closing mechanism, and a garbage bag conveying mechanism and a laser coder covered by the upper box cover are also installed on the installation partition, and the installation partition A heat-sealing mechanism and a cutting mechanism are installed below. The identification method of the present invention is simple and reliable, can effectively prevent users from finding loopholes during use, and greatly reduces the chances of users defrauding garbage classification points.

technical field [0001] The invention belongs to the field of big data management, and in particular relates to a garbage collection device and a garbage classification management system using the same. Background technique [0002] At present, in terms of waste classification management and evaluation, big data has been used to track and manage enterprises and homes. Through big data management, the number of times users have classified waste, the correctness of classification, and the number of violations of regulations can be correctly analyzed to correctly analyze the number of times users have classified waste. According to the actual situation, users are rewarded or punished accordingly, such as rewarding cash for users who actively carry out garbage classification or exchanging points for some products, and publishing them.
